I normally don't ask for help but just say goodbye to things that get ruined, but I want my tablet to work again so, here's the problem:
The SDcard (internal) appears as unmounted, it won't recognize an external SD Card and when I go into Settings->Storage, it crashes.
This is what I did:
- Connected the Tablet (without external SD card) to the computer and copied an .apk file to the tablet. I was stupid enough, though, to delete a folder called "external_sd", and I think that was the beginning of my problem, although...
- I installed the .apk file on the tablet and everything worked fine.
- Inserted the external SD card and the tablet didn't read it at all
- The previously-mentioned installed app now crashes when I try to open it, so I uninstalled it.
- Restarted tablet with external SD card inside
- Attempted to re-install the .apk from the internal SD card, but it showed as unreadable
- The external SD is still unreadable and the internal one doesn't get any better.
Tablet specs: Coby Kyros MID7033, ICS (4.0.3)
